Anyone know the pros and cons of the SELECT Program vs the CORE Program? I can't seem it find it anywhere.

Select goes to PA 3rd and 4th year
Select is more expensive (pay out of state tuition)
Select students have additional courses/activities that are supposed to build leadership and 'emotional intelligence'
Select students are paired with a mentor who they skype with every week, I believe

We meet with one of our faculty mentors for 1 hour once a month. This block I skype with my Lehigh Valley mentor. Next block I'll meet on campus with my USF mentor. That's just how my group decided to split it up, some groups switch mentors each month.
